TIDMSAM For immediate release: Syndicate Asset Management Plc ("Syndicate" or the "Company") Result of General Meeting Syndicate Asset Management Plc (AIM: SAM), the fund management group with approximately GBP5.9 billion under management, announces that all the resolutions proposed at its General Meeting, held earlier today, were duly passed. It is anticipated that the 510,000,000 new ordinary shares of 0.2 pence each and issued at 1 pence each, comprising 310,000,000 Subscription Shares and 200,000,000 Deferred Consideration Shares, will be admitted to trading on AIM at 8:00 a.m. on 27 May 2009 and rank pari passu in all respects with the existing Ordinary Shares of 0.2 pence each in the capital of the Company. David Pinckney, Chairman of Syndicate, commented: "We are pleased that the resolutions have been passed.
